About

Outside In is a Portland nonprofit clinic that integrates gender-affirming care into all of its health services for transgender and gender-diverse patients. Services include affirming primary care, gender-affirming hormone therapy via Oregon's informed-consent model, HIV/STI testing, mental health support, and a transgender ID/name-change project. The clinic has served trans patients since the mid-1990s and welcomes patients regardless of legal name; people can become patients through the clinic intake process on the website.
